Java中的if / else代码有什么问题?它不起作用

时间:2014-06-07 12:13:59

标签: java android if-statement control-flow

我试图在android中编程,但我的if / else代码无效。基本上,它是一个测验应用程序,用于确定一个人的答案是否正确。但无论答案是什么,输出都是'否则'。

中给出的输出
if(message=="panama canal"){
         Answer="Correct!";
    }
    else {
        Answer="Totally wrong";

    }

1 个答案:

答案 0 :(得分:0)

在Java中,您需要将字符串与equals方法进行比较。如上所述,您正在比较两者是否是同一个对象。